Transaction 186950f952f9fcc8495f954960db87befae003a8f2906dd3b3486eeeeebab15e

1 Input
2 Outputs
  • 186950f952f9fcc8495f954960db87befae003a8f2906dd3b3486eeeeebab15e:0
  • value  33023593
    address  38VjDAU4MLBFCvSkVN5oQmevmugfpZ7GKA
  • 186950f952f9fcc8495f954960db87befae003a8f2906dd3b3486eeeeebab15e:1
  • value  378910445
    address  361u1zrhRAXwkBkH8WXkWva7pM6ndYaRDF